ADVANCING DECENT WORK AND ECONOMIC GROWTH THROUGH FAIR EMPLOYMENT AND STUDENT EMPOWERMENT INITIATIVES
Supporting SDG 8: "Decent Work and Economic Growth," 15% of UM students engage in work placements, gaining essential skills for employment. Policies ensure fair wages, pay equity, and anti-discrimination, while benefits include maternity/paternity leave, tuition waivers, and performance incentives. Grievance mechanisms and union support promote workplace harmony and industrial peace. Students also benefit from opportunities like the Ayala Young Leaders Congress, enhancing employability and professional networks.
